We probably look more like an agency previously, but no, we just have a dedicated customer success team that if people need a little bit more hands-on help, we'll give that.
If you want to do things by yourself, we're good to kind of just let you use the software as well.
On the SaaS side, so our fees can range anywhere between $500 a month up to $5,000 a month.
Okay.
On how much of our services you're using, how much of the software you're using.
Yeah, at the moment it's broken up by features and as well just what kind of number of accounts that you're using with us.
So if you just have one Instagram account or one Snapchat account, that's right down there on the bottom tier.
If you don't need much support from our team, you're kind of in that category.
But if you've got multiple accounts that you're trying to manage and you want access to all of the features, all that user-generated content, the analytics that I was talking about, that's where you start to go up the tiers as well.
Founded in early 2014.
So we've been going just over four and a half years now.
So stories came out at the end of 2013.
Did they really?
yeah so snapchat snapchat came out of the stories end of 2013. we came out early 2014 and i can tell you when we're out there pitching our software initially we'll get a lot of funny looks from people being like what is this thing uh and so you know you mentioned are we more like a marketing agency back then we actually were because we're out there pitching the tools and we're saying hey do you want to use our tools and people saying i don't get this thing
uh actually you know we want to we want to reach this audience but we don't understand this would you guys mind helping us out and so that's what we did in the beginning you know we we did everything from creative services so coming out with campaign ideas content creation um right through to executing campaigns then over time we kind of took all of our learnings here and keep feeding it back through to the product feeding it back through the product and eventually the market got to a point where it educated enough
Instagram came along, Facebook came along.
All these new platforms were there.
And for us, we did do a little bit of a pivot, I'd say, away from being a Snapchat-focused company to a Stories platform.
